I am glad things start up OK, but how do I set up the Connection and then test that it handles it OK?


I really have not thought about this a great deal - so this is off the top of my head .... (a) create a client componet - declare it as dependent on the server component (so the server will be launched whe the client request a refercence - or alternatively - declare the server as activation="true")., (b) in the initialize or start method of you client - invoke operations against the appropriate server.
